The Louisville Original's Discount Gift Certificates Now on Sale!
Click here to purchase yours now!
https://www.powercard.com/secure/rewards.asp?cityid=15

These certificates sell out fast. There is a limited supply of these certificates for each restaurant and there will be hundreds of customers taking advantage of this sale.

DETAILS: The certificates are discounted 30-50 percent with all proceeds benefiting the Louisville Originals. They are good for six months from date of purchase and cannot be used for alcohol, tax or gratuity. The certificates are not redeemable for cash, and no change will be given. Only one gift certificate may be used per table per visit, and cannot be used on holidays or for special events.
